We led you to this great Mayan city that had its period of greatest splendor in the late classical period (DC. S. VI), due to the large civil engineering work was built where the white-road network (SAC BEOOB) more extensive the northern part of the peninsula at that time and thus Coba became the most powerful commercial center of the area by controlling the trade. It also has the 3rd largest pyramid in the Mayan world (pyramid Nohoch mul 42 m. high). At the end you can swim in the cool waters of the world Mayan sacred underground in a cenote.
